  • Abstract
    Distributed real-time control system modeling (DRCSM) provides an abstract architecture for the implementation of distributed control systems with hard real-time constraints. In order to leverage model continuity, XML-based description of model informal description is required, which supports the reuse of components and model information interoperability. By separating the platform-independent from the platform-dependent concerns, DRCSM enables a great deal of flexibility in choosing control platforms as well as a great deal of automation in the validation and synthesis of control software.
